Meeting TikTok's Live Requirements: Before You Go Live

Before you can even think about enabling live access, you need to meet TikTok's criteria. This isn't just about having an account; it's about building a foundation that signals to TikTok you're ready for live streaming.

Age and Account Age:

  • Minimum Age: You must be at least 16 years old to go live on TikTok. This is a strict requirement, so ensure your profile reflects your accurate age.
  • Account Maturity: TikTok often requires a certain level of account activity and engagement before granting live access. This could mean having a certain number of followers, consistent posting, and general engagement with the platform. Consistency is key here.

Community Guidelines Adherence:

This is paramount. TikTok has strict community guidelines. Repeated violations can lead to account suspension, preventing you from ever going live. Familiarize yourself with the rules, and always prioritize responsible content creation.

Enabling Live Access: A Step-by-Step Guide

Once you meet the requirements, enabling live access is relatively straightforward. However, the exact steps might vary slightly depending on your device and TikTok app version. Here's a general guide:

  1. Open the TikTok App: Launch the TikTok app on your smartphone.
  2. Navigate to Your Profile: Tap on your profile picture located in the bottom right corner of the screen.
  3. Access Settings: Look for the three dots (or a similar icon) usually found in the upper right corner of your profile page. This opens your settings menu.
  4. Find Creator Tools: In settings, search for options related to "Creator Tools," "Settings and Privacy," or something similar. The exact phrasing may differ.
  5. Live Options: Within the Creator Tools or settings, you should find an option specifically for "Live," "Live Streaming," or "Go Live."
  6. Enable Live: If you meet the criteria, you should see an option to enable live streaming. If you don't, review the requirements again, ensure your account information is accurate and wait for your account to mature.

Boosting Your Live Stream's Impact: Pro-Tips

Going live is only half the battle. To truly make an impact, consider these tips:

Plan Your Content:

Don't just wing it! Plan your live stream's topic, duration, and any interactive elements you'll include. A well-structured live stream keeps viewers engaged.

Promote Your Live Stream:

Announce your upcoming live stream on your other social media platforms and engage with your followers in the days leading up to it. Generate excitement!

Engage with Your Audience:

Respond to comments, answer questions, and create a sense of community during your live stream. Interaction is vital for keeping viewers tuned in.

Use Relevant Hashtags:

Use trending and relevant hashtags to help people discover your live streams. Think about what your audience is searching for.

Analyze Your Performance:

After each live stream, review your analytics to see what worked and what didn't. Use this data to improve future streams.
